Well - turns out the threads on the cap were stripped, expansion tank as well! Replaced both with parts from dealers (Chico, CA and near Sacramento). Engine still heats up so I jumpered the fan but may have been too late, at the last stop I saw coolant leaking underneath - likely the pump gasket. I'...

Re: Scared to loosen 18 year old thermostat bolts!
My favorite penetrating oil is PB Blaster. You can spray that on the bolts & let it seep in for 10 minutes or so. You can also do it a couple of times over a day to be sure. Good job with trying it out at the junkyard. I think some have replace these bolts with a hex head fastener, I'm not famil...
